}</code></pre>]]></description><link>http://localhost:5000/2012/10/24/my-debian-installation-tips</link><guid isPermaLink="true">http://localhost:5000/2012/10/24/my-debian-installation-tips</guid><dc:creator><![CDATA[Mixu]]></dc:creator><pubDate>Wed, 24 Oct 2012 07:00:00 GMT</pubDate></item><item><title><![CDATA[Writing about technical topics like it's 2012]]></title><description><![CDATA[<p>For some reason, a lot of technical writing is still done as if the reader didn&#39;t have access to the Internet. Having written two books (<a href="http://book.mixu.net/">Mixu&#39;s Node book</a> and <a href="http://singlepageappbook.com/">Single page apps in depth</a>) in the past year, I&#39;ve had some time to think about what good technical writing might be. There are several things that could be improved:</p>
<p><strong>1. Assume the reader has Internet and Google capabilities.</strong> Skip the parts that are covered better elsewhere or that will go out of date quickly. For example, installation tutorials are never up to date. I&#39;ll generally skip the sales pitch for the technology as well, since I&#39;m here to tell you about the tech, not sell you on using it.</p>
<p><strong>2. Keep it short and to the point.</strong> I hate books that try to be cute or clever with me - if I want a story, I&#39;ll go read fiction. Similarly, don&#39;t surprise the reader with irrelevant sections. <em>Just because you wrote it doesn&#39;t mean it should exist</em>. I keep a crap file where all the useless text goes, and I usually have a couple of chapters worth of text that I delete. I&#39;ve written several chapters on the history of a piece of tech, and always deleted them in the end.</p>
<p><strong>3. Use teasers, lists, tables and code blocks.</strong> Assume that the reader can get bored quickly, so throw in something interesting quick (a teaser) and support skimming readers with subheadings, lists and other structural elements.</p>
<p><strong>4. Don&#39;t treat everything as equally important.</strong> The easiest way to write a book about a piece of tech is to take the API, and then cover each and every function in it. It&#39;s also the worst possible way to do it. Unless you are writing the API docs, you should avoid talking about everything and focus on the interesting parts.</p>
<p>As a reader, if I want to find out more, I can always read the API or code. What is much more important is understanding what are the neat things that I can do with the new tech, what kinds of patterns are common in using it and why you as the author think they are good or bad. Talk about how the pieces fit together. If everything is equally important, then nothing stands out. I like getting the author&#39;s angle on things, even if I might disagree with their choices, I still feel like I gain insight.</p>
<p><strong>5. Give me a choice in formats.</strong> Provide HTML, PDF, epub and mobi versions of long texts. Converting html for the Kindle just requires running <a href="https://github.com/visionmedia/masteringnode/blob/master/Makefile#L45">one command</a> with Calibre, so I wish more authors gave me the option to download their writing. For example, I wish I could get Google&#39;s tutorials for Android as a Kindle mobi book, since that&#39;s how I like to read long form writing.</p>
<p><strong>6. Help me navigate.</strong> Often, when I like what I read, I&#39;ll want to read more. Don&#39;t force me to go page by page through your writing. If you have a blog, have an archive that can show all the content, and let me get an idea of what else you&#39;ve written about at a glance (a most popular list always helps).</p>

git reflog</code></pre>]]></description><link>http://localhost:5000/2012/04/06/git-tips-and-tricks</link><guid isPermaLink="true">http://localhost:5000/2012/04/06/git-tips-and-tricks</guid><dc:creator><![CDATA[Mixu]]></dc:creator><pubDate>Fri, 06 Apr 2012 07:00:00 GMT</pubDate></item><item><title><![CDATA[Mechanical keyboards rock!]]></title><description><![CDATA[<p>I&#39;m a big believer in having the best tools possible for the job. I&#39;ve gone through at least 3 <a href="http://programmers.stackexchange.com/questions/2254/what-are-good-keyboards-for-programming">Microsoft Ergonomic Keyboard 4000&#39;s</a>, and used to think those were the best keyboards ever (as did <a href="http://www.codinghorror.com/blog/2010/10/the-keyboard-cult.html">Jeff Atwood</a>).</p>
<p>Well, there is <a href="http://www.overclock.net/t/491752/mechanical-keyboard-guide">whole world of keyboards that are even better</a>, namely: buckling spring keyboards (e.g. the IBM Model M), Cherry MX switch keyboards and Topre switch keyboards.</p>
<p>I got this one for my place - Cherry MX brown switches, which are less noisy (though definitely they could be even more silent):</p>
<p><a href="http://blog.mixu.net/files/2012/02/IMG_20120217_001846.jpg"><img title="IMG_20120217_001846" src="http://blog.mixu.net/files/2012/02/IMG_20120217_001846.jpg" alt="" width="512" height="384" /></a></p>
<p>The major difference between a mechanical keyboard and a regular one is in the feel of the keys. Mechanical keyboards have metallic springs, while cheaper keyboards just have some flexible plastic. After a short while typing on the MS Ergonomic keyboard started feeling like typing on a mushy piece of plastic compared to the mechanical keyboard. I do kind of miss the more ergonomic split layout, but typing is just a lot nicer overall on a mechanical keyboard.</p>
<p>I ended up buying two keyboards, both with Cherry MX switches (~110 USD from <a href="http://elitekeyboards.com/">here</a>). I didn&#39;t get a buckling spring keyboard, because they are more noisy and there aren&#39;t any space-saving tenkeyless models available. The third alternative - keyboards with Topre switches - are more expensive (~300+ USD) and have been described as less tactile. I&#39;ll probably get a Topre keyboard eventually anyway, just so I can try it out.</p>
<p>Here is the new keyboard I use at work, which has Cherry MX blue switches (a bit more noisy than my other keyboard, but definitely one I prefer):</p>
<p><a href="http://blog.mixu.net/files/2012/02/IMG_20120216_183611.jpg"><img title="IMG_20120216_183611" src="http://blog.mixu.net/files/2012/02/IMG_20120216_183611.jpg" alt="" width="512" height="384" /></a></p>
<p>Best purchase in a long time!</p>

]]></description><link>http://localhost:5000/2012/01/19/how-to-thinkpad_acpi-and-fan-control-on-arch</link><guid isPermaLink="true">http://localhost:5000/2012/01/19/how-to-thinkpad_acpi-and-fan-control-on-arch</guid><dc:creator><![CDATA[Mixu]]></dc:creator><pubDate>Thu, 19 Jan 2012 08:00:00 GMT</pubDate></item><item><title><![CDATA[Performance benchmarking Socket.io 0.8.7, 0.7.11 and 0.6.17 and Node's native TCP]]></title><description><![CDATA[<p>I&#39;ve been working with Socket.io quite a bit recently. It&#39;s a great library. However, after upgrading to 0.8.x, I ran into problems with increased CPU usage. Since performance is very important for high traffic pubsub implementations, I decided to investigate this further - and try to quantify the performance impact of upgrading to a newer version of Socket.io.</p>
<p>I wrote a benchmarking suite (<a href="https://github.com/mixu/siobench">siobench</a>). The benchmark is rather simple. Clients connect one at a time, and a new client is only allowed to connect when the previous one is connected. When the server has used up 5000 milliseconds of CPU time, the benchmark is stopped. Every second, every connected client sends a single message which is echoed back by the server (<a href="https://github.com/mixu/siobench">more details</a>).</p>
<p>This workload is geared towards a situation where Socket.io is used to notify people of things as part of a larger application: e.g. most of the load is assumed to be idling connections rather than real-time messaging like in, say, a multiplayer game.</p>
<p>The &quot;end of test&quot; condition is 5000 ms of CPU time, because this seemed to be a easy way to give all implementations the same amount of time. CPU usage % is not accurate, since it is dependent on how much CPU time the process gets over a particular amount of wallclock time. In the graphs the CPU usage % calculated over a 100ms interval, while usertime and systime are the actual numbers reported at that particular time.</p>

<p><strong>Some notes on performance</strong></p>
<p>The relative performance is more interesting.</p>
<p>First, the node TCP speed represents the highest achievable performance on this benchmark, since it only uses the built-in TCP implementation. Compared to this, Socket.io is has about 1/3 of the performance (~ 2300 vs ~8000 connections) when using WebSockets.</p>
<p>Second, it appears that 0.8.7 is about 20% slower than 0.6.17 on this benchmark. If I remember correctly, Socket.io 0.7 switched to a new protocol, and there are clearly some performance improvements over 0.7.11 in 0.8.7 (+100 connections in this bench); it&#39;s just that the overall performance is still worse in this benchmark than in the old 0.6.17 branch.</p>
<p><strong>Working towards higher-performance</strong></p>
<p>As this is just a simple benchmark, I don&#39;t really have solutions - only some suggestions.</p>
<p><strong>1) A CI build that includes benchmarks and community contributed test cases</strong></p>
<p>First, I&#39;d love to see a CI build for Socket.io that would include performance benchmarks and community contributed test cases.</p>
<p>However, currently setting up a CI build for Socket.io is difficult because <a href="https://github.com/LearnBoost/socket.io/issues/519">the bundled test suite only works on OSX</a>. It would be a lot easier to contribute if the tests worked on other platforms.</p>
<p>I am hoping that as <a href="https://github.com/LearnBoost/engine.io">Engine.io gets going</a>, the test suite will be fixed so that it can be run on other platforms. Otherwise, contributing improvements will be tricky/impossible since there is no way to tell whether the code works.</p>
<p><strong>2) More realistic performance test scenarios</strong></p>
<p>The current test scenario is rather limited in that it mostly tests performance in terms of establishing connections (without terminating them). I&#39;d love to hear more realistic scenario suggestions, particularly from people who have run into memory usage issues.</p>
<p><a href="https://github.com/mixu/siobench">siobench</a> is only a starting point: it&#39;s way better than just looking at htop and wondering whether performance was better in the last version or not. There are still specific questions that should be formulated as replicable tests.</p>
<p><strong>3) A polling transport that works on Node.js</strong></p>
<p>I did write tests for the xhr-polling transport for Socket.io as well. These showed much worse performance, around:</p>
<p><ul>
<li>~ 550 connections on Socket.io 0.6.17 (vs ~2300 using WS)</li>
<li>~ 450 connections on Socket.io 0.8.7 (vs ~ 1900 using WS)</li>
</ul>
However, the xhr-polling is severely broken in that it stops connecting after 4-5 connections on Node v0.4.12. So I had to force each load generating client to only make four connections and then spawn a new load generating process to work around the problem. I wouldn&#39;t vouch for the accuracy of the test with xhr-polling until the xhr-polling transport is fixed on Node when using socket.io-client (it&#39;s been broken for the last three releases, though).</p>
<p><strong>4) Comparative benchmarks</strong></p>
<p>Hopefully, this will help with performance testing new releases of Socket.io and other Comet libraries. Since the plan is that Engine.io will allow people to work with a lower level than Socket.io, there might be new performance oriented versions, and it would be useful to see benchmarks for those. Re: the other Node.js pubsub frameworks: I can&#39;t benchmark Faye, because it does not provide the right API out of the box, and Juggernaut uses Socket.io internally.</p>
<p>I&#39;m going to use siobench it for internal testing to ensure that the pubsub implementation I am working on (built over Socket.io) will not have performance regressions.</p>

]]></description><link>http://localhost:5000/2011/11/10/my-arch-linux-setup</link><guid isPermaLink="true">http://localhost:5000/2011/11/10/my-arch-linux-setup</guid><dc:creator><![CDATA[Mixu]]></dc:creator><pubDate>Thu, 10 Nov 2011 08:00:00 GMT</pubDate></item><item><title><![CDATA[Nginx, Websockets, SSL and Socket.IO deployment]]></title><description><![CDATA[<p>I&#39;ve spent some time recently figuring out the options for deploying Websockets with SSL and load balancing - and more specifically, Socket.IO - while allowing for dual stacks (e.g. Node.js and another dev platform). Since there seems to be very little concrete guidance on this topic, here are my notes - I&#39;d love to hear from you on your implementation (leave a comment or write about and link back)...</p>
<p><strong>The goal here is to:</strong></p>
<p><ol>
<li>Expose Socket.io and your main application from a single port -- avoiding cross-domain communication</li>
<li>Support HTTPS for both connections -- enabling secure messaging</li>
<li>Support the Websockets and Flashsockets transports from Socket.io -- for performance</li>
<li>Perform load balancing for both the backends somewhere -- for performance</li>
</ol>
<span style="font-size: 20px; font-weight: bold;">Socket.io&#39;s various transports</span></p>
<p>Socket.io supports multiple different transports:</p>
<ul>
<li>WebSockets -- which are essentially long lived HTTP 1.1 requests, which after a handshake upgrade to the Websockets protocol</li>
<li>Flash sockets -- which are plain TCP sockets with optional SSL support (but Flash seems to use some older SSL encryption method)</li>
<li>various kinds of polling -- which work over long lived HTTP 1.0 requests</li>
</ul>
<h2>Starting point: Nginx and Websockets</h2>
<p>Nginx is generally the first recommendation for Node.js deployments. It&#39;s a high-performance server and even includes support for proxying requests via the <a href="http://wiki.nginx.org/NginxHttpProxyModule">HttpProxyModule</a>.</p>
<p>However, -- and this should be made much obvious to people starting with Socket.io -- the problem is that while Nginx can talk HTTP/1.1 to the client (browser), it talks HTTP/1.0 to the server. Nginx&#39;s default HttpProxyModule does not support HTTP/1.1, which is needed for Websockets.</p>
<p>Websockets 76 requires support for HTTP/1.1 as the handshake mechanism is not compatible with HTTP/1.0. What this means is that if Nginx is used to reverse proxy a Websockets server (like Socket.io), then the WS connections will fail. So no Websockets for you if you&#39;re behind Nginx.</p>
<p>There is a workaround, but I don&#39;t see the benefit: use a TCP proxy (there is a <a href="https://github.com/yaoweibin/nginx_tcp_proxy_module">custom module for this by Weibin Yao</a>, <a href="http://www.letseehere.com/reverse-proxy-web-sockets">see here </a>). However, you cannot run another service on the same port (e.g. your main app and Socket.io on port 80) as the TCP proxy does not support routing based on the URL (e.g. /socket.io/ to Socket.io and the rest to the main app), only simple load balancing.</p>
<p>So the benefit gained from doing this is quite marginal: sure, you can use Nginx for load balancing, but you will still be working with alternative ports for your main app and Socket.io.</p>
<p><h2>Alternatives to Nginx</h2>
Since you can&#39;t use Nginx and support Websockets, you&#39;ll need to deal with two separate problems:</p>
<p><ol>
<li>How to terminate SSL connections and</li>
<li>How to route HTTP traffic to the right backend based on the URL / load balance</li>
</ol>
If you want to run two services on the same port, then you will have to terminate SSL connections before doing anything else. There are several alternatives for SSL termination:</p>
<p><ul>
<li><a href="http://www.stunnel.org/">Stunnel</a>. Supports multiple SSL certificates per process, does simple SSL termination to another port.</li>
<li><a href="https://github.com/bumptech/stud">Stud</a>. Only supports one SSL certificate per invocation, does simple SSL termination to another port.</li>
<li><a href="http://www.apsis.ch/pound/">Pound</a>. An SSL-termination-capable reverse proxy and load balancer.</li>
<li>Node&#39;s https. Can be made to do anything, but you&#39;ll have to write it yourself.</li>
</ul>
If you choose Stunnel or Stud, then you need a load balancer as well if you plan on having more than one Node instance in the backend.</p>
<p>HAProxy is not <em>generally compatible</em> with Websockets, but Socket.IO <span style="text-decoration: underline;">contains code which works around this issue</span> and allows you to use HAProxy. This means that the alternatives are:</p>
<p><ul>
<li>Stunnel for SSL termination + HAProxy for routing/load balancing</li>
<li>Stud for SSL termination + HAProxy for routing/load balancing</li>
<li>Pound (SSL and routing/load balancing)</li>
</ul>
I haven&#39;t looked into Pound more - mainly as I could not find info on it&#39;s TCP reverse proxying capabilities (see the section on Flash sockets below), but <a href="http://the-rig.refinery29.com/post/7263057532/pound-and-varnish">it seems to work for these guys</a>.</p>
<p><h2>Setting up Stunnel</h2>
The Stunnel part is quite simple:</p>
<pre class="hljs"><code><span class="hljs-setting">cert = <span class="hljs-value">/path/to/certfile.pem</span></span>
<span class="hljs-comment">; Service-level configuration</span>
<span class="hljs-title">[https]</span>
<span class="hljs-setting">accept = <span class="hljs-value"><span class="hljs-number">443</span></span></span>
<span class="hljs-setting">connect = <span class="hljs-value"><span class="hljs-number">8443</span></span></span></code></pre><p>If you only have one Node instance, you can skip setting up HAProxy, since you don&#39;t need load balancing.</p>
<p><h2><strong>Setting up HAProxy</strong></h2>
<strong>Would you like Flash Sockets with that?</strong></p>
<p>Note that we need TCP mode in order to support Flash sockets, which do not speak HTTP.</p>
<p>Flash sockets are just plain and simple TCP sockets, which will start by sending the following payload: &#39;&lt;policy-file-request/&gt;&#39;. They expect to receive a Flash cross domain policy as a response.</p>
<p>Since Flash sockets don&#39;t use HTTP, we need a load balancer which is capable of detecting the protocol of the request, and of forwarding non-HTTP requests to Socket.io.</p>
<p>HAProxy can do that, as it has two different modes of operation:</p>
<p><ul>
<li>HTTP mode - which allows you to specify the backend based on the URI</li>
<li>TCP mode - which can be used to load balance non-HTTP transports.</li>
</ul>
<strong>Main frontend</strong></p>
<p>We accept connections on two ports: 80 (HTTP) and 8443 (Stunnel-terminated HTTPS connections).</p>
<p>By default, everything goes to the backend app at port 3000. Some HTTP paths are selectively routed to socket.io</p>
<p>TCP mode is needed so that Flash socket connections can be passed through, and all non HTTP connections are sent to the TCP mode socket.io backend.</p>

]]></description><link>http://localhost:5000/2011/02/24/quick-tip-fix-flash-audio-stutter-on-fedora-14-64bit</link><guid isPermaLink="true">http://localhost:5000/2011/02/24/quick-tip-fix-flash-audio-stutter-on-fedora-14-64bit</guid><dc:creator><![CDATA[Mixu]]></dc:creator><pubDate>Thu, 24 Feb 2011 08:00:00 GMT</pubDate></item><item><title><![CDATA[Cascading file loading in Node.js]]></title><description><![CDATA[<p>One of my favorite features of Kohana 3 is it&#39;s cascading filesystem - so I decided to implement it for Node.js. A cascading filesystem is an elegant solution to a common problem: how to provide a mechanism for loading modules and reusing code?</p>
<p>The following image from Kohana 3&#39;s docs shows an example:</p>
<p><a href="http://blog.mixu.net/files/2011/02/cascading_filesystem.png"><img title="cascading_filesystem" src="http://blog.mixu.net/files/2011/02/cascading_filesystem-223x300.png" alt="" width="223" height="300" /></a></p>
<h2>Benefits</h2>
The key benefits are:
<ol>
<li><strong>Consistency</strong>. All your application files, including views, controllers, models and other data such as translation messages are loaded using one, easy-to-understand mechanism.</li>
<li><strong>Easy reuse</strong>. Without a cascading file system, you&#39;ll have to copy and move files around if you want to use someone else&#39;s libraries or modules. With a cascading file system, you just place the module in your application, and enable cascading for that directory.</li>
<li><strong>Transparent extensibility</strong>. What if you want to override one part of a module (say, a view) but don&#39;t want to modify your copy of the module (e.g. so that you can update without manually merging changes). A cascading filesystem allows you to selectively replace files in 3rd party code simply by providing your own version of the file.</li>
</ol>
<h2>The code</h2>
<ul>
<li><a href="https://github.com/mixu/hmvc-cfs">https://github.com/mixu/hmvc-cfs</a>/</li>
<li>It&#39;s only about 90 lines of code, see <a href="https://github.com/mixu/hmvc-cfs/blob/master/index.js">this file</a></li>
</ul>
<h2>Load order and file name resolution</h2>
The load order for my implementation is:
<ol>
<li><strong>Application path</strong> - files under ./application/ are always checked first.</li>
<li><strong>Module paths</strong> - set modules([&#39;./modules/my-module&#39;]) to enable module loading. Files from modules are loaded from in the order they are added.</li>
<li><strong>System path</strong> - files under ./system/ are loaded if no alternative exists.</li>
</ol>
<strong>Assumptions about file and class names</strong>
Files are assumed to be <strong><em>lowercase</em></strong>. <strong><em>Underscores in class names</em></strong> are replaced by slashes (so Controller_User becomes ./application/classes/ controller/user.js).
<strong>Performance impact</strong>
Requests are cached, so that additional calls to find_file() do not cause additional stat() calls in the filesystem. This is insignificant anyway, since Node.js servers are persistent so the cascading search is only done once per server instance for each file (not once per request).
<strong>Loading 3rd party code</strong>
The loaded files do not need to be &quot;compatible&quot; in any way other than layout in the file system. For example, while Cfs.factory(&#39;some_other_lib&#39;) loads the file from ./application/ classes/some/other/lib.js, that file does not actually need to contain a class named some_other_lib; just that it returns something via module.exports.
